在移动互联网高速发展的今天,微信小程序以其轻量化、易访问的特性,迅速成为连接用户与服务的新桥梁。微信小程序开发实战(第2版)作为一本全面升级的教程,旨在帮助开发者快速掌握小程序开发的核心技能,从零基础到熟练运用,解锁数字化时代的创新可能。
小程序框架概览:首先,本书将带你深入了解微信小程序的基本架构和运行机制,包括小程序的文件结构、页面构成以及生命周期管理,为后续开发打下坚实基础。
配置高效开发环境是迈向成功的第一步。书中详细介绍了如何使用微信官方的小程序开发工具,从下载安装到项目初始化,确保每位开发者都能快速上手,无缝接入开发流程。
WXML与WXSS:作为小程序的标记语言和样式语言,WXML与WXSS的设计理念与HTML/CSS相似而又有所不同。本书通过实例讲解,让你掌握这两种语言的独特语法与应用技巧。
JavaScript交互逻辑:深入剖析小程序中的数据绑定、事件处理和API调用,通过实战案例教你如何利用JavaScript实现复杂的业务逻辑和动态效果。
小程序的丰富组件库是其魅力之一。本书不仅列举了常用组件的功能与使用方法,还深入探讨了如何自定义组件以满足特定需求。同时,对微信提供的各类API进行分类解析,如网络请求、文件操作、位置服务等,让你的程序功能更加完善。
理论学习之后,实践出真知。本书精选多个实战项目,涵盖电商、社交、工具等多个领域,从需求分析到代码实现,全程指导。特别强调性能优化技巧,包括代码压缩、资源加载策略、页面渲染优化等,确保小程序运行流畅,提升用户体验。
最后,本书还介绍了小程序的发布流程、版本管理和数据分析,帮助开发者了解如何通过后台数据监控用户行为,持续迭代优化产品,实现商业目标。
微信小程序开发实战(第2版)不仅是一本技术手册,更是一部引导开发者进入小程序生态、实现创意落地的指南。无论是对于编程新手还是有一定经验的开发者,本书都提供了宝贵的资源和实用的技巧,助力你在小程序开发领域大展拳脚。在快速变化的技术浪潮中,掌握微信小程序开发能力,无疑将为你的职业生涯开启更多可能。